mirror of
https://github.com/perstarkse/minne.git
synced 2026-03-27 20:01:31 +01:00
51 lines
1.6 KiB
HTML
51 lines
1.6 KiB
HTML
{% extends "head_base.html" %}
|
|
{% block body %}
|
|
<style>
|
|
form.htmx-request {
|
|
opacity: 0.5;
|
|
}
|
|
</style>
|
|
|
|
<div class="min-h-[100dvh] container mx-auto px-4 sm:px-0 sm:max-w-md flex justify-center flex-col">
|
|
<h1
|
|
class="text-5xl sm:text-6xl py-4 pt-10 font-bold bg-linear-to-r from-primary to-secondary text-center text-transparent bg-clip-text">
|
|
Minne
|
|
</h1>
|
|
<h2 class="text-2xl font-bold text-center mb-8">Login to your account</h2>
|
|
|
|
<form hx-post="/signin" hx-target="#login-result">
|
|
|
|
<div class="form-control">
|
|
<label class="floating-label">
|
|
<span>Email</span>
|
|
<input type="email" placeholder="Email" class="input input-md w-full validator" required />
|
|
<div class="validator-hint hidden">Enter valid email address</div>
|
|
</label>
|
|
</div>
|
|
|
|
<div class="form-control mt-4">
|
|
<label class="floating-label">
|
|
<span>Password</span>
|
|
<input type="password" class="input validator w-full" required placeholder="Password" minlength="8" />
|
|
</div>
|
|
|
|
<div class="form-control mt-4">
|
|
<label class="label cursor-pointer justify-start gap-4">
|
|
<input type="checkbox" name="remember_me" class="checkbox " />
|
|
<span class="label-text">Remember me</span>
|
|
</label>
|
|
</div>
|
|
<div class="mt-4" id="login-result"></div>
|
|
<div class="form-control mt-6">
|
|
<button id="submit-btn" class="btn btn-primary w-full">
|
|
Login
|
|
</button>
|
|
</div>
|
|
</form>
|
|
<div class="divider">OR</div>
|
|
<div class="text-center text-sm">
|
|
Don't have an account?
|
|
<a href="/signup" hx-boost="true" class="link link-primary">Sign up</a>
|
|
</div>
|
|
</div>
|
|
{% endblock %} |